An Inquiry into the Reception and Reinterpretation of The Analects of Confucius in The Historical Records
In the course of writing The Historical Records,Sima Qian demonstrated a high regard for The Analects of Confu-cius.Due to the influence of the revival of Confucianism in the Western Han Dynasty and Sima Qian's own respect for Confu-cius,The Historical Records greatly appreciates The Analects:the former treats the latter as an admissible historical source,and bases its evaluation of political ideas and historical figures on the latter.Based on the acceptance of The Analects,The His-torical Records also reinterprets The Analects:in terms of content,Sima Qian transforms the discourses of The Analects into narratives;in terms of ideology,The Historical Records reflects a clear tendency towards political philosophy.At the same time,the reinterpretation of The Analects in The Historical Records also had a positive impact on the classicalization of The Analects.
